How the AI BMC For Fashion Ecommerce Brands Template Works in Creately
Step 1: Define Your Customer Segments
Identify your primary and secondary fashion customer segments. Include demographics, style preferences, price sensitivity, and shopping behavior. AI helps surface hidden segments based on data patterns. This ensures your brand speaks to the right audiences.
Step 2: Clarify Your Value Propositions
Outline what makes your fashion brand unique in a crowded ecommerce market. Consider design, quality, sustainability, exclusivity, or convenience. AI suggestions help refine differentiation. Strong value propositions drive loyalty and conversion.
Step 3: Map Channels and Customer Relationships
Document how customers discover, purchase, and engage with your brand. Include ecommerce platforms, social media, marketplaces, and email. AI highlights gaps or over-reliance on single channels. This supports balanced growth.
Step 4: Identify Revenue Streams
List all revenue sources such as direct sales, subscriptions, drops, or collaborations. Evaluate pricing models and seasonal impacts. AI helps compare profitability across streams. This guides smarter revenue planning.
Step 5: Outline Key Resources
Capture critical assets like design talent, suppliers, technology, and brand equity. Include both internal and external resources. AI assists in identifying underutilized assets. This strengthens operational readiness.
Step 6: Define Key Activities and Partnerships
Map core activities such as design, marketing, fulfillment, and customer support. Add strategic partners like manufacturers and logistics providers. AI reveals efficiency opportunities. This improves scalability.
Step 7: Analyze Cost Structure
Break down fixed and variable costs including production, marketing, and returns. Assess cost drivers by channel and product line. AI supports margin optimization insights. This ensures sustainable growth.

Data Needed for your AI BMC For Fashion Ecommerce Brands
Key data sources to inform analysis:
Customer demographics, preferences, and purchase history
Website and ecommerce analytics including conversion and retention
Marketing performance data across paid, organic, and social channels
Product cost, pricing, and margin information by collection
Inventory, fulfillment, and return rate data
Supplier, manufacturing, and logistics cost details
Competitive benchmarks and market trend reports
